AFFECTIONATE & PLAYFUL GIRL!
- Meet Pebbles - an extremely affectionate and playful girl who loves human company and will often be found sleeping on beds or next to her foster carers.
- She doesn't like being left alone for too long during the day and would suit a home with another pet to act as a mentor/ friend when the house is quiet.
- During the night Pebbles loves snuggling in the bed next to her foster carers and will often try and find a hand to touch.
- She is litter trained, clean and loves both wet and dry food, even enjoying a treat of kitten milk during the day.
- She enjoys sitting and watching TV or movies on the bed with her carers and also enjoys playing fishy games on the tablets.
- Pebbles has experienced life with dogs and young children and would be suited for homes where someone is home more often and where she won't be left alone for more than 5 hours.
NOTE: Pebbles has received her 3 kitten vaccinations and microchip. The adoption fee also covers her sterilisation at the age of 6 months which can be done at a vet clinic in Busselton, Vasse or Bunbury.

Our adoption process includes a two week trial period to ensure you and your adopted pet are the right fit.
The adoption fee of $300.00 includes desexing, microchip (including transfer of ownership), flea and worm treatment, 2 vaccinations and vet check.
SAFE Busselton requests that all persons adopting a cat adhere to responsible containment practices. As per the current Cat Laws in WA we encourage people to keep their rescued cat as a permanent indoor cat or with access to a safe cat run. It is no longer desirable to allow your cat to wander onto adjoining properties. Confident cats can also be trained to walk on a harness and lead. We ask that owners be responsible and keep their adopted cat safe at all times so that you will have a long and loving life together.
